Output 63e74f20e3b7da8ba6ec57f67e9da2e59fa88250c62e3ba50e71a17efcc4c993:54

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 93bc24d9505a3f89c307b76c9c9208540bb7a03c980f44e8ab4bd1985373b282
address
bc1pjw7zfk2stglcnsc8kakfeysg2s9m0gpunq85f69tf0ges5mnk2pqp2trxz
transaction
63e74f20e3b7da8ba6ec57f67e9da2e59fa88250c62e3ba50e71a17efcc4c993
spent
true